Evidenziazione del codice e completamento automatico andato in Xcode
Domanda
Sto lavorando in un team e recentemente abbiamo perso tutta la nostra sintassi evidenziando nel nostro progetto Xcode. È un problema in tutti i nostri ambienti, quindi non è un problema con la macchina locale. Abbiamo tutti cancellato i nostri dati derivati, eliminato le intestazioni precompilate in/var/cartelle/. Inoltre, tutti stanno ricevendo il seguente errore nella loro console:
1/12/12 9:40:42.126 PM Xcode: IDEIndexingClangInvocation: Failed to save PCH file: /Users/sashimiblade/Library/Developer/Xcode/DerivedData/Project-gfgcpcthwcmainhhtgpavaqacqkr/Index/PrecompiledHeaders/Project-Prefix-gwxtmfzfhffkhmardmbbgmpwrntg_ast/Project-Prefix.pch.pth
Qualche idea? Questo mi ha fatto impazzire per diversi giorni e non posso vivere senza il mio completamento automatico o la sintassi!
Soluzione
OK, l'ho capito. Avevo la trama principale nell'area del framework del mio progetto e Xcode stava cercando di risolvere la trama di core come framework anche se era solo una binaria e le intestazioni associate. Così ho spostato la trama di core in una cartella con le mie altre classi, ho rimosso il vecchio percorso del core-trama dai percorsi di ricerca della libreria e ho anche fatto saltare via i percorsi di ricerca dell'intestazione e ora il mio completamento automatico e l'evidenziazione del codice sono tornati !! Penso che questo sia un bug in Xcode ...
Altri suggerimenti
Non sto cercando di ottenere alcun rappresentante - voglio solo fare ciò che @EricGoldberg e @CornPuff menzionati nei commenti sopra si distinguono. Semplicemente è un ENORME risparmia tempo.
Completamento automatico andato in xcode? (un vero evento per essere onesti)
Segui questi passaggi super-facile:
Aggiungi una nuova riga (o qualsiasi altra semplice modifica, per quella materia) al tuo
YourAppName-Prefix.pch
fileSalva
Ricostruisci il tuo progetto
Ed è riparato automaticamente magicamente! :-)